Seasonique
About this product:
SEASONIQUE is an extended-cycle birth control pill that gives women four periods per year instead of 12 (one per month). With Seasonique, women get a low dose of estrogen during their period, which may provide benefits including less breakthrough bleeding Like all birth control pills, SEASONIQUE prevents pregnancy by providing hormones (estrogen and progestin) that suppress ovulation (the maturing and release of an egg) and other related changes your body goes through in preparation for a pregnancy. If taken correctly on a daily basis, SEASONIQUE is as much as 99% effective in preventing pregnancy, but there is still a 1% chance that you could get pregnant. Furthermore, missing a pill or taking a pill a few hours later than normal can decrease the effectiveness.
